According to the forecast of analysts CEC, in 2016/17 MG sown area under maize in South Africa will increase by 26.5% in the year to 2.46 million ha. In particular, the area of sowing of the white grain will be increased by 43.4% to 1.46 million hectares of yellow corn 8.2%, to 1.01 million ha.
As noted in the CEC report, the main incentives for expanding acreage under grain this season will be beneficial for farmers, the domestic price of corn, and forecasters predicted the sufficient precipitation in the period of sowing and growing season of crops.
Recall that in 2015/16 as a result of severe drought caused by El Nino, the gross harvest of corn in South Africa fell to 7.5 million tons, which is 25% lower than the previous season. The reduction of the corn crop necessitated the importation in 2016/17 MG to about 2 million tons of grain.
